Use computer software packages, such as Minitab or Excel, to solve this problem. The owner of Showtime Movie Theaters, Inc, would like to predict weekly gross revenue as a function of advertising expenditures. Historical data for a sample of eight weeks follow. a. Develop an estimated regression equation with the amount of television advertising as the independent variable (to 1 decimal). Revenue = + TVAdv b. Develop an estimated regression equation with both television advertising and newspaper advertising as the independent variables (to 2 decimals). c. Is the estimated regression equation coefficient for television advertising expenditures the same in part (a) and in part (b)? d. Predict weekly gross revenue for a week when $3.6 thousand is spent on television advertising and $1.8 thousand is spent on newspaper advertising?Explanation / Answer
From statistical software output,
a) Revenue = 82.6 + 4 TVAdv
b) Revenue = 75.18 + 4.95 TVAdv + 1.78 NewsAdv
c) No
d) For TVAdv = 3.6, NewsAdv = 1.8,
Revenue = 75.18 + 4.95 (3.6) + 1.78 (1.8)
Revenue = 96.204
